San Antonio ranks among worst cities for holiday travel
San Antonio is among the nation’s worst cities for holiday travel, according to a new report from Forbes Advisors. To put a number on it, SA ranked as the sixth-most miserable U.S. city for travel between November and January, pulling in dismal score of 22.2 out of 100.
